What is an engineering manager?

An Engineering Manager is a professional who oversees engineering teams, guiding them to achieve project goals and company objectives. They are responsible for managing people, processes, and resources, ensuring that engineering projects are completed on time and within budget. Engineering Managers also collaborate with other departments, mentor team members, and help develop technical strategies. Their role bridges the gap between technical engineering tasks and organizational leadership.

How does an engineer manager typically support professional development within their team?

Engineer Managers play a key role in fostering the growth of their team members by providing regular feedback, identifying learning opportunities, and encouraging participation in training or mentorship programs. They often help engineers set clear career goals, guide them through skill development, and advocate for their advancement within the organization. By promoting a culture of continuous improvement and collaboration, Engineer Managers help team members stay motivated and aligned with both personal and company obj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an engineering manager, and why are they important?

To excel as an Engineering Manager, you need a strong technical background in engineering principles, project management experience, and often a relevant degree such as in engineering or computer science. Familiarity with project management tools (like Jira or Asana), version control systems (such as Git), and possibly certifications like PMP or Agile Scrum Master are typically required. Exceptional leadership, communication, and conflict-resolution skills help you motivate teams and manage stakeholders effectively. These competencies are crucial for delivering successful projects, fostering a productive team environment, and driving organizational goals.

How much should an engineering manager be paid?

The salary of an engineering manager varies based on experience, industry, and location, but typically ranges from $100,000 to $180,000 annually in many regions. Senior engineering managers or those in high-demand sectors can earn over $200,000, often supplemented with bonuses and stock options. Compensation also depends on skills in project management, leadership, and technical expertise.
